Understanding Monomers and Polymers: The Building Blocks of Life
Before we jump into the answer key, let's quickly review the core concepts. A monomer is a small, single molecule that can be bonded to other identical molecules to form a larger chain or network. Think of them as the individual LEGO bricks. A polymer, on the other hand, is a large molecule composed of many repeating monomer units. This is like the completed LEGO structure – a complex arrangement built from simpler units.
Different types of monomers create different polymers, leading to a wide variety of materials with unique properties. For example, the monomer glucose forms the polymer starch (in plants) and glycogen (in animals), while amino acids form proteins, and nucleotides form DNA and RNA. #### H2: Identifying Monomers and Polymers
This section likely tests your ability to recognize monomers and polymers based on their chemical structures. You'll be presented with diagrams or chemical formulas and asked to identify whether they represent a monomer, a polymer, or neither. Key things to look for include:
Repeating Units: Polymers show clear repeating units of the same monomer.
Bonding: Monomers are linked together via covalent bonds (strong chemical bonds) to form polymers.
Size: Polymers are significantly larger than their constituent monomers.

1. Identify the Monomer: Carefully examine the chemical structure or formula provided. Look for repeating units or distinctive functional groups that identify the monomer type (e.g., glucose, amino acid, nucleotide).
2. Analyze the Bonding: Determine how the monomers are linked together. This will often involve covalent bonds, such as peptide bonds in proteins or glycosidic bonds in carbohydrates.
3. Determine the Polymer Type: Based on the type of monomer and the bonding pattern, identify the polymer formed (e.g., starch, cellulose, protein, DNA).
4. Consider Polymer Properties: If asked about polymer properties, relate these properties back to the type of monomer and the structure of the polymer. For example, a highly branched polymer might be more flexible than a linear one.

2. What are some real-world examples of polymers? Polymers are ubiquitous in everyday life; examples include plastics (polyethylene, PVC), fabrics (nylon, polyester), and natural materials like rubber and DNA.
3. How do the properties of polymers differ from those of their monomers? Polymers typically have different physical and chemical properties than their monomers due to the large size and the intermolecular forces between the polymer chains.
4. What is the difference between addition and condensation polymerization? Addition polymerization involves monomers adding to each other without the loss of any atoms, while condensation polymerization involves the monomers joining together with the elimination of a small molecule like water.

Watson When, in late March of 1953, Francis Crick and I came to write the first Nature paper describing the double helical structure of the DNA molecule, Francis had wanted to include a lengthy discussion of the genetic implications of a molecule whose struc ture we had divined from a minimum of experimental data and on theoretical argu ments based on physical principles. But I felt that this might be tempting fate, given that we had not yet seen the detailed evidence from King's College. Nevertheless, we reached a compromise and decided to include a sentence that pointed to the biological significance of the molecule's key feature-the complementary pairing of the bases. It has not escaped our notice, Francis wrote, that the specific pairing that we have postulated immediately suggests a possible copying mechanism for the genetic material. By May, when we were writing the second Nature paper, I was more confident that the proposed structure was at the very least substantially correct, so that this second paper contains a discussion of molecular self-duplication using templates or molds. We pointed out that, as a consequence of base pairing, a DNA molecule has two chains that are complementary to each other.
